Chevy working on production Impala Midnight Edition
Sat, Dec 13 2014To put together the Impala Blackout concept for SEMA, Chevrolet didn't need to go much further than its accessories catalog. The in-house connection is what could make it possible for Chevy to get a production version of the Blackout into dealers this model year, with its few bits of chrome trim and dark detailing on the 19-inch aluminum wheels set into an abyss of gloss black paint, black Bowtie, grille surround, rear spoiler and mirror caps. The interior is black leather, with stainless steel for the sill plates and pedals, and an 11-speaker Bose audio system, and it gets the optional 305-horsepower, 3.6-liter V6. The brand's marketing director for cars and crossovers, Steve Majoros, told Edmunds that it could come in late spring, and that it will be called "Midnight Edition." Majoros didn't give any indication of pricing or if the production car will be spec'd out like the concept. Tesla Model S owners can hack their car with the VisibleTesla app. The free, open source app allows users to check on and control the status of the car and its subsystems, similar to Tesla's official apps. VisibleTesla can also be used to schedule certain automated commands. For example, its creator, Joe Pasqua, has his car send him a text message reminding him to bring his bags with him when he enters the grocery store parking lot. Other users have the car remind them if the car is not charging at a certain time, or schedule the car to turn on the heat before departure. The Luka EV is a project to build an affordable, lightweight, retro-looking, road-legal electric car in one year. The team wants to get the car certified for use on EU roads by September 2015. They have goals of achieving a driving range of 300 kilometers (about 186 miles), keeping the cost under ˆ20,000 (about $22,280 US at current rates) and the weight under 750 kilograms (about 1,650 pounds). The builders recently completed their first range test of the working vehicle, which uses in-hub motors for propulsion. Learn more at the Luka EV project page on Hackaday. Tue, Jul 29 2014Bentley has been awarded the Carbon Trust Standard for reductions of carbon, water use and waste production in manufacturing. The Carbon Trust is an organization that helps groups such as businesses and governments reduce carbon emissions, use of energy and resources, and waste output. From 2011 to 2013, Bentley reduced CO2 emissions by 16 percent per car manufactured, curtailed water use by 35.7 percent, and saw significant waste reductions. Darran Messem of Carbon trust says, "Bentley is clearly passionate about continuing to improve its environmental performance, which is reflected by the fact the company has consistently invested in new technology." A professor from the University of Michigan has found fuel cycle analysis to be too flawed to be relied upon for measuring CO2 impacts of transportation fuels. Professor John DeCicco of the university's Energy Institute feels that the flaws in calculating the carbon footprint of liquid fuel production and combustion make such lifecycle analysis impractical. He suggests, instead, to focus to carbon capture. Since capturing CO2 directly from a vehicle is probably never going to happen, DiCicco believes the solution is to capture carbon from the atmosphere in sectors outside of transportation. Says DiCicco, "Research should be ramped up on options for increasing the rate at which CO2 is removed from the atmosphere and on programs to manage and utilize carbon fixed in the biosphere, which offers the best CO2 removal mechanism now at hand. Such strategies can complement measures that control the demand for liquid fuels by reducing travel activity, improving vehicle efficiency and shifting to non-carbon fuels."
